Action item from the Inkwheel markdown pipeline postmortem: sanitization ran after template expansion, so user-supplied HTML briefly rendered unescaped in preview mode. The fix reorders the pipeline stages and adds a regression test per stage. As a new contractor, please review the stage ordering diagram before touching any renderer code. The canonical pipeline documentation is maintained on the internal page below.

wiki page, fajof-tajef: https://vault.tolvaqio.corp/board/pipeline/pages/ticket/c20d7f984bcc9e12

Image slimming for the Tarnwick release pipeline: we switched the base image to the minimal Oxbow variant, trimming roughly 400 MB. Strip build tools in the final stage and verify the slimmed image still reaches the metrics store. For that smoke check, it must connect using the following.

replica DSN, tawef-hahap: mysql://eliix_svc:FiIC0jz@db-394a.lumiclabs.internal:5432/holius

# Approvals: Per-Tenant Rate Quotas (Meterloft)

Quick rules for on-call: any tenant asking for a quota bump beyond 2x their plan needs an approval, no exceptions, even at 3am. Temporary bumps under 2x are fine — just log them in the Meterloft runbook and they'll auto-expire in 24 hours. Permanent changes always need a ticket plus sign-off. If you're unsure whether something counts as permanent, ask first. The approver for all quota changes is listed below.

account owner for bawip-tahag: Raleth Quenok

## Deploying the Gatewick Proctor Queue

Deploys are pretty painless: push to main, wait for the pipeline, then watch the queue drain dashboard for five minutes. If candidates pile up mid-exam, roll back first and ask questions later — the queue replays safely. Everything the workers care about lives in one config block, shown here for reference.

settings of bafof-yagef:
JOROX_PIN=8740
JOROX_TENANT=pelox
JOROX_METRICS_HOST=metrics.jorox.qorvelworks.internal
JOROX_SEAL=seal_c78f63c1
JOROX_STANDBY_TEAM=norax